Leafleting in Soli-hell

04-09-2007 16:49

Leafleting at Sanford House, Solihull
A couple of Birmingham NoBorders activists did some lealfeting today at the immigration reporting centre in Solihull, West Midlands. An 'advice leaflet' and another about Sandford House were handed out to asylum seekers who are forced to go there to 'sign on' every week or every month, along with some literature about the upcoming Gatwich No Border Camp. Copies of the leaflet exposing Sandford House and what really goes on there were also given out to the public in town, many of whom seemed to not give a toss about migrants and their mistreatment at the hands of immigration authorities.

Trial in Agrigento: No to the criminalisation of solidarity

03-09-2007 11:35

Since August 22, 2007, seven Tunisian fishermen have been on trial in Agrigento (Sicily), accused of “assisting illegal immigration”. They risk up to 15 years imprisonment. Prosecuted as human traffickers, what they did was in fact just their basic duty of solidarity: on August 8, near the island of Lampedusa, they picked up 44 passengers from a boat in distress at sea and brought them to the harbour.
Without their intervention the shipwrecked people - including two pregnant women and two children - would propably have suffered the same fate as the thousands of migrants and refugees who in the last years have drowned while trying to reach the European coasts.

The attempt to deport Learco Chindamo

01-09-2007 15:19

Learco Chindamo was 15 years old when he killed headmaster Philip Lawrence outside his London school in 1995. He was sentenced to be “detained at Her Majesty’s pleasure”—the formal judgment pronounced in the most serious juvenile cases as an alternative to handing down a life sentence to a child. He can be considered for parole after serving a tariff (minimum) of 12 years detention, which expires in January 2008 when Chindamo will be 27.
